45. If x = 2, y 3& z= 5. Find the value of 4x y +Z.​

Answer:

∴ The value of equation 4xy+z when x=2,y=3 and z=5 is 29.

Step-by-step explanation:

  • In context with question asked,
  • We have to find the value of equation 4xy+z.
  • The given values are, x=2,y=3 and z=5.
  • To find the value of given equation, we have to put the values of x,y and z in the given equation.
  • So, the given equation is,

               4xy+z = 4\times 2\times 3+5

                          = 24+5

                          = 29

  • ∴ The value of equation 4xy+z when x=2,y=3 and z=5 is 29.
